Security Reliability Testing, within the context of cryptocurrency, options trading, and financial derivatives, necessitates a rigorous evaluation of algorithmic integrity and robustness. This involves scrutinizing the mathematical foundations underpinning pricing models, order execution strategies, and risk management protocols. A key focus is identifying potential vulnerabilities to adversarial inputs or unforeseen market conditions, ensuring algorithmic behavior remains predictable and aligned with intended objectives, particularly in high-frequency trading environments. The process incorporates formal verification techniques and extensive backtesting to validate algorithmic performance across diverse market scenarios.
